Output d8acd62b39204891d5de8c32f4a4800d5c9bbddccdb5d2268dc82a064c2aa915:1

value
2814340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d22e0b3671713c70a50ea498113c6f29553524f7 OP_EQUAL
address
3LrLz1PCXwVLfNU29wfPBkGiJzjBC9xCxQ
transaction
d8acd62b39204891d5de8c32f4a4800d5c9bbddccdb5d2268dc82a064c2aa915
spent
true